- The distance between Crete, Ne, Usa and West Point, Ny, Usa is approximately 1,925 km or 1,196 mi.
- To reach Crete, Ne in this distance one would set out from West Point, Ny bearing 277.6°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Crete, Ne bearing 262.4° or W .
- Crete, Ne has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as West Point, Ny has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 0 °C (0°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.4 °C (6.1°F) more in Crete, Ne.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 458.2 mm (18 in) less which is equivalent to 458.2 l/m² (11.25 US gal/ft²) or 4,582,000 l/ha (489,846 US gal/ac) less. About 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0° higher in Crete, Ne than in West Point, Ny.
